| 26 | #include "config.h" |
| 27 | #include "DFGVariableAccessDataDump.h" |
| 28 | |
| 29 | #if ENABLE(DFG_JIT) |
| 30 | |
| 31 | #include "DFGGraph.h" |
| 32 | #include "DFGVariableAccessData.h" |
| 33 | #include "JSCInlines.h" |
| 34 | |
| 35 | namespace JSC { namespace DFG { |
| 36 | |
| 37 | VariableAccessDataDump::VariableAccessDataDump(Graph& graph, VariableAccessData* data) |
| 38 | : m_graph(graph) |
| 39 | , m_data(data) |
| 40 | { |
| 41 | } |
| 42 | |
| 43 | void VariableAccessDataDump::dump(PrintStream& out) const |
| 44 | { |
| 45 | unsigned index = std::numeric_limits<unsigned>::max(); |
| 46 | for (unsigned i = 0; i < m_graph.m_variableAccessData.size(); ++i) { |
| 47 | if (&m_graph.m_variableAccessData[i] == m_data) { |
| 48 | index = i; |
| 49 | break; |
| 50 | } |
| 51 | } |
| 52 | |
| 53 | ASSERT(index != std::numeric_limits<unsigned>::max()); |
| 54 | |
| 55 | if (!index) { |
| 56 | out.print("a" ); |
| 57 | return; |
| 58 | } |
| 59 | |
| 60 | while (index) { |
| 61 | out.print(CharacterDump('A' + (index % 26))); |
| 62 | index /= 26; |
| 63 | } |
| 64 | |
| 65 | if (m_data->shouldNeverUnbox()) |
| 66 | out.print("!" ); |
| 67 | else if (!m_data->shouldUnboxIfPossible()) |
| 68 | out.print("~" ); |
| 69 | |
| 70 | out.print(AbbreviatedSpeculationDump(m_data->prediction()), "/" , m_data->flushFormat()); |
| 71 | } |
| 72 | |
| 73 | } } // namespace JSC::DFG |
| 74 | |
| 75 | #endif // ENABLE(DFG_JIT) |
